Q1: Can I buy an academic degree certificate online?

A: Legitimate academic certificates are awarded by accredited organizations after finishing needed coursework. While you can buy a certificate of conclusion from trusted platforms (e.g., Coursera for a verified certificate), you can not buy an authentic degree without finishing the program. Beware of degree‑mill frauds that provide phony diplomas.

Q2: Are totally free SSL certificates safe to use?

A: Yes, complimentary authorities such as Let's Encrypt provide domain‑validated certificates that secure data. Nevertheless, they do not have the higher validation and service warranty used by paid certificates. For e‑commerce or sites managing sensitive information, a paid OV or EV certificate is recommended.

Q3: How long does it take to get a digital certificate after purchase?

A: For a lot of SSL certificates, issuance can be immediate (DV) or take 1‑3 organization days (OV/EV). Present cards and e‑gift certificates are delivered through email within minutes. Professional accreditations frequently require exam scheduling; the certificate is awarded after passing.
